All businesses, individuals and other establishments generating noise must comply with the National Environment (Noise Standards and Control) Regulations, 2003, issued under the National Environment Act.
No person may emit noise above permitted levels without prior authorisation.
Failure to comply will result in enforcement action, including fines, prosecution, confiscation of equipment, suspension of operations, or closure of premises in accordance with the law.
